Keeping in mind the resale value of your camping tent can aid you establish a practical rate and attract serious buyers. Here are some tips:

1. Conduct a thorough inspection.
Whether you're selling a tent in a brick-and-mortar shop or online, it's crucial that you perform a complete assessment of the tools to make sure that every little thing is as anticipated. This will certainly assist you set a sensible cost and prevent any type of surprises for potential buyers.

Begin by very carefully checking out the camping tent's assembly instructions and checking that all parts are consisted of. If the outdoor tents has flexible functions, examination them to ensure that they function as advertised.

Additionally, examine that the outdoor tents is free from any issues like an opening in the roofing or an abrasion in the material. Any type of such defects could significantly affect resale worth.

2. Tidy the camping tent.
Tents accumulate a layer of dust that discolorations them and makes them odoriferous. It is very important to completely clean up a tent prior to placing it in storage space, as packing a damp one is an invite for mildew.

Gather your cleansing products, consisting of a tub, water, soap and gear cleaner. Immerse the camping tent and upset it with a nonabrasive sponge or cloth to eliminate as much dirt as possible.

You might additionally take this opportunity to freshen the water resistant layers and coverings. This will make certain the camping tent keeps rain out along with it did when you bought it. Be sincere regarding your tent's problem when you provide it on the internet-- buyers value openness.
